Definitions and Meaning of ladybird in English

Wordnet

ladybird (n)

small round bright-colored and spotted beetle that usually feeds on aphids and other insect pests

Webster

ladybird (n.)

Any one of numerous species of small beetles of the genus Coccinella and allied genera (family Coccinellidae); -- called also ladybug, ladyclock, lady cow, lady fly, and lady beetle. Coccinella seplempunctata in one of the common European species. See Coccinella.
